I have a friend with the sig
Simplify above her kitchen sink. Another friend was tell a group of women that she has signs all over her home that say Simplify. Her husband asked her, "What does Simplify mean to you??" We all laughed about that and the sign that used to say "Simplify, Simplify" with the second word crossed off.

As a professional home and office organizer I started thinking what does Simplify mean to me? Does it mean only having as much food in the house as we eat in a week, does it mean only having only so many cleaning products on hand, does it mean only so many clothes, so many decorations for holidays or for the home? Does it mean not buying anything new for our homes? Does any of this ring a bell with you?

Simplify does not mean that our homes need to look like a model home all the time and looking very sparce and empty. For instance we can have more than one photograph out on the table, we can have more than one or figurines decorating our home. We can have a room full of craft, sewing, scrapbooking resources. To simplify is to get rid of clutter and have a place for everything and everything living neatly in its place. Or having the right tool for the project we are working on and being able to access that readily.

I recently did just one simple thing which has simplified my life and it has nothing to do with clutter. I am vertically challenged (5'3") and can't reach high places without dragging up a chair or 'stretching my gizzard' as my mother used to say. (I know we don't have gizzards). I bought a small, space saving, portable, sturdy stool to stand on to reach high places. Now I don't grumble and complain when I have to reach something out of the cupboard or on closet shelves. It was so helpful to have a stool always at the ready I got the bright idea of having one downstairs as well instead of spending the time to go upstairs everytime I needed it. Just this one simple thing has simplified my life and has made my life so much easier and actually happier.

To me that is what Simplify means. Enabling us to be more productive, have less stress in our lives, and as a result be happier.
